1. Design Of Your Patio Door

First, you should consider the basic design of your patio and home. You will want a door that complements the architectural style of your property and gives it more curb appeal.

2. Size And Fit Needed For Your Patio Door

If your sliding glass patio doors do not fit precisely, it can lead to costly adjustments or a door that doesn’t function properly. Knowing the exact dimensions you need for your patio sliding glass doors or any other type of patio door you choose is crucial.

3. Desired Material For Your Sliding Patio Doors

Selecting the best material for your patio door is essential for durability and maintenance. Common materials used for patio doors include wood, vinyl, and fiberglass.

4. How Much Energy Efficiency
Your Patio Door Will Provide

Your new patio door should contribute to the overall energy efficiency of your home. Look for patio doors with high energy efficiency ratings, such as those with energy-efficient glass and proper insulation.

7. How Much Maintenance You Want To
Commit To At Your St. Johns, FL Home

Before deciding on a patio door, factor in the level of maintenance they require. Some materials, such as vinyl, require minimal upkeep, while wood doors may need regular painting or staining.

8. Natural Light And Views For Your Home In
The St. Augustine-Jacksonville Beach Area

Patio doors are perfect for bringing in natural light and providing scenic views of your outdoor space. In fact, this is one of the main reasons that homeowners opt for sliding glass patio doors when building or remodeling a home.

When shopping, factor in the amount of glass you want in your patio door to optimize natural light without compromising privacy or energy efficiency. You should also consider the view you’ll have from both inside and outside your home.
